In the central match of the 24th round of the championship of France PSG in your field beat Lille – 4:3.
Already by the 17th minute, the Parisians were leading by two goals after the goals of Kylian Mbappe and Neymar. Before the break, the defender of the guests Bafode Diakite played one ball.
In the 58th minute, Lille earned a penalty, which forward Jonathan David converted. After 10 minutes, the guests stepped forward. Distinguished striker Jonathan Bamba.
From the second defeat in a row, PSG was saved by Mbappe, who equalized in the 87th minute. But Messi’s goal from a free-kick in the 5th stoppage minute brought the victory to the Parisians.
PSG remained the leader of the French championship. Lille is in 5th place. In the next round, the Parisians will play with Marseille on February 26. Lille takes over Brest on 24 February.
- French Championship, round 24
PSG – Lille – 4:3 (2:1)
Goals: Mbappe, 11, 87, Neymar, 17, Messi, 90 + 5 – Diakite, 24, David, 58, from the penalty spot, Bamba, 69
